
网页导出文档怎么改成Excel
在当今的数字化工作环境中,将网页导出文档转换为Excel是一个常见的需求。使用数据导出功能、借助第三方工具、手动复制粘贴、编写自定义脚本是解决这一问题的主要方法。本文将详细阐述这些方法,并提供实际操作步骤和技巧。
一、使用数据导出功能
许多网页应用程序和网站提供了内置的数据导出功能,允许用户将数据直接导出为Excel格式。以下是一些常见的步骤和注意事项:
1.1 查找导出选项
首先,检查网页或应用程序是否提供了导出选项。通常,这些选项可以在以下位置找到:
- 菜单栏或工具栏中
- 设置或配置页面
- 数据表格或报告页面的顶部或底部
1.2 选择导出格式
在找到导出选项后,通常会提供多种导出格式供选择,如CSV、Excel、PDF等。选择Excel格式以确保数据在导出后能够直接在Excel中打开和编辑。
1.3 导出数据
选择导出格式后,点击导出按钮。系统将生成一个Excel文件并提示下载。下载完成后,您可以使用Excel打开该文件,并进行进一步的编辑和分析。
二、借助第三方工具
如果网页本身不提供导出功能,您可以借助第三方工具将网页数据转换为Excel格式。这些工具通常包括浏览器扩展、在线转换服务和桌面软件。
2.1 浏览器扩展
许多浏览器扩展可以帮助您将网页数据导出为Excel。例如,Google Chrome的“Web Scraper”和“Table Capture”扩展都可以捕获网页上的表格数据并导出为Excel。
- 安装扩展:访问Chrome Web Store,搜索并安装相关扩展。
- 使用扩展:打开包含数据的网页,启动扩展,选择需要导出的表格数据,然后选择导出为Excel格式。
2.2 在线转换服务
一些在线服务可以帮助您将网页数据转换为Excel。例如,Convertio、Online-Convert等网站都提供这种服务。
- 访问网站:打开转换服务网站。
- 上传文件:上传包含网页数据的文件(如HTML文件)。
- 选择格式:选择转换为Excel格式。
- 下载文件:完成转换后,下载生成的Excel文件。
2.3 桌面软件
一些桌面软件可以帮助您将网页数据导出为Excel。例如,Adobe Acrobat Pro可以将PDF文件转换为Excel,Microsoft Power Query可以从网页中提取数据并导出为Excel。
- Adobe Acrobat Pro:打开PDF文件,选择“导出PDF”,选择“Microsoft Excel”,然后保存文件。
- Microsoft Power Query:打开Excel,选择“数据”选项卡,选择“从网页”,输入网页URL,然后提取数据并保存为Excel文件。
三、手动复制粘贴
如果网页数据量较小,手动复制粘贴也是一种简单有效的方法。
3.1 选择数据
使用鼠标选择网页上的数据。对于表格数据,可以从第一个单元格开始,拖动鼠标选择整个表格。
3.2 复制数据
按下Ctrl+C(Windows)或Command+C(Mac)复制选中的数据。
3.3 粘贴数据
打开Excel,选择目标单元格,按下Ctrl+V(Windows)或Command+V(Mac)粘贴数据。根据需要调整数据格式和样式。
四、编写自定义脚本
对于需要频繁转换网页数据的用户,编写自定义脚本可以自动化这一过程。常用的编程语言包括Python和JavaScript。
4.1 使用Python
Python的pandas库和BeautifulSoup库可以帮助您提取网页数据并导出为Excel。
import pandas as pd
import requests
from bs4 import BeautifulSoup
获取网页内容
url = 'https://example.com/data'
response = requests.get(url)
soup = BeautifulSoup(response.content, 'html.parser')
提取表格数据
table = soup.find('table')
data = []
for row in table.find_all('tr'):
cols = row.find_all('td')
data.append([col.text for col in cols])
创建DataFrame并导出为Excel
df = pd.DataFrame(data)
df.to_excel('output.xlsx', index=False)
4.2 使用JavaScript
JavaScript的Puppeteer库可以帮助您自动化网页数据提取,并导出为Excel。
const puppeteer = require('puppeteer');
const fs = require('fs');
const xlsx = require('xlsx');
(async () => {
const browser = await puppeteer.launch();
const page = await browser.newPage();
await page.goto('https://example.com/data');
// 提取表格数据
const data = await page.evaluate(() => {
const rows = Array.from(document.querySelectorAll('table tr'));
return rows.map(row => {
const cols = Array.from(row.querySelectorAll('td'));
return cols.map(col => col.innerText);
});
});
// 创建Excel文件
const wb = xlsx.utils.book_new();
const ws = xlsx.utils.aoa_to_sheet(data);
xlsx.utils.book_append_sheet(wb, ws, 'Sheet1');
xlsx.writeFile(wb, 'output.xlsx');
await browser.close();
})();
五、数据清理与格式化
无论使用哪种方法,将网页数据导出为Excel后,通常需要进行数据清理与格式化,以确保数据的准确性和可读性。
5.1 数据清理
数据清理是指删除无用的数据、修正错误数据、处理缺失数据等。可以使用Excel的内置功能或编程语言来进行数据清理。
- 删除空行和空列:选择空行或空列,右键选择“删除”。
- 查找和替换:使用Ctrl+H打开查找和替换对话框,输入需要替换的内容。
- 数据验证:使用数据验证功能确保数据的准确性。
5.2 数据格式化
数据格式化是指调整数据的显示格式、设置单元格样式等。可以使用Excel的内置功能或编程语言来进行数据格式化。
- 设置单元格格式:选择单元格,右键选择“设置单元格格式”,根据需要选择格式。
- 应用样式和模板:使用Excel的样式和模板功能快速应用预定义的样式。
- 创建图表和图形:使用Excel的图表和图形功能可视化数据。
六、常见问题与解决方案
在将网页导出文档转换为Excel的过程中,可能会遇到一些常见问题。以下是一些解决方案:
6.1 数据丢失或格式混乱
如果在导出过程中数据丢失或格式混乱,可以尝试以下解决方案:
- 检查导出选项:确保选择了正确的导出选项和格式。
- 使用不同工具:尝试使用不同的工具或方法进行导出。
- 手动调整格式:导出后手动调整数据格式和样式。
6.2 编码问题
如果导出后出现乱码或编码问题,可以尝试以下解决方案:
- 检查网页编码:确保网页使用了正确的编码格式(如UTF-8)。
- 设置导出编码:在导出时设置正确的编码格式。
- 使用编程语言处理:使用编程语言处理数据时,指定正确的编码格式。
6.3 大数据量处理
对于大数据量的网页导出,可能会遇到性能和内存问题。可以尝试以下解决方案:
- 分批导出:将数据分批导出,减少单次导出的数据量。
- 优化代码:优化脚本或程序的代码,提升性能。
- 使用专业工具:使用专业的数据处理工具和软件。
七、总结与推荐
将网页导出文档转换为Excel是一项常见且重要的任务。通过使用数据导出功能、借助第三方工具、手动复制粘贴、编写自定义脚本等方法,您可以高效地完成这一任务。每种方法都有其适用场景和优缺点,选择适合您需求的方法尤为重要。
推荐的方法如下:
- 数据导出功能:适用于网页或应用程序提供导出选项的情况。
- 第三方工具:适用于网页不提供导出选项且数据量较大的情况。
- 手动复制粘贴:适用于数据量较小且不频繁的情况。
- 自定义脚本:适用于需要频繁转换数据且具备编程能力的情况。
无论选择哪种方法,数据清理与格式化都是确保数据准确性和可读性的关键步骤。希望本文提供的详细操作步骤和解决方案能帮助您高效地将网页导出文档转换为Excel。
相关问答FAQs:
1. 如何将网页导出的文档转换成Excel格式?
- Q: 我从网页上导出了一个文档,但是它是以什么格式保存的呢?
- A: 网页导出的文档通常是以HTML格式保存的。如果您想将其转换成Excel格式,可以使用特定的工具或软件来进行转换。
2. 有哪些工具可以将网页导出的文档转换成Excel格式?
- Q: 我想将网页导出的文档转换成Excel格式,有没有一些推荐的工具或软件?
- A: 是的,有很多工具和软件可以帮助您将网页导出的文档转换成Excel格式。一些常用的工具包括:Adobe Acrobat Pro、Google Sheets、Microsoft Excel等。您可以选择根据您的需求和喜好来选择适合您的工具。
3. 如何在Excel中编辑网页导出的文档?
- Q: 我已经将网页导出的文档转换成了Excel格式,现在我想在Excel中对其进行编辑和修改。有什么方法吗?
- A: 当您将网页导出的文档转换成Excel格式后,您可以使用Excel的各种功能来编辑和修改文档。您可以修改单元格内容、调整格式、添加公式等。通过选择合适的工具和功能,您可以对文档进行丰富的编辑。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4255444